Everyone is different, but for my public speaking gigs (at least the high profile ones) I feel at my best and most powerful wearing a trouser suit in an unusual colour and some bright lipstick (good for photos). For this, Hugo Boss and The Fold are superb but a little spendy.

Do you know whether you will be standing at a lectern or sitting down on a stage? Or - god forbid - a bar stool? If so, then trousers are usually a safer bet. And if you don't know, then ask.

You want something comfortable to stand in, OK for sitting and taking questions on stage in case that's happening, and not too warm as it can get hot up there.

I might wear a long dress with flat boots, or cigarette pants, vest in same colour, and a contrasring oversized blazer (in a colour that really suits me), with loafers.
